Former Angels first baseman Casey Kotchman was placed on the bereavement list by the Atlanta Braves on Wednesday and left the team to be with his mother who has been hospitalized with an undisclosed medical condition.
Apparently, Kotchman got the news of this sudden illness following the Braves’ game in New York Tuesday night and called Braves manager Bobby Cox after midnight to let him know he would be leaving the team and heading to Florida.
Kotchman’s mother is the principal of an elementary school in Florida. His father, Tom, is manager of the Angels’ rookie league team in Orem, Utah and a long-time minor-league coach, manager and scout in the Angels’ system.
